Transaction 708178d419c40f636dd6339a2326a731e9e413e5837b333a986634816efc75ae

1 Input
2 Outputs
  • 708178d419c40f636dd6339a2326a731e9e413e5837b333a986634816efc75ae:0
  • value  3097
    address  1D9MtPPFUUd1Xi4SGCuFTnciwm2QbMDPfY
  • 708178d419c40f636dd6339a2326a731e9e413e5837b333a986634816efc75ae:1
  • value  682501
    address  1PEQG1mMVQU5K73EQQaWd7uQTthPH7cuLZ